Some young men may experience symptoms of testicular and epididymal pain, and this symptom is often more severe when standing or walking. In addition to this symptom, the patient may also suddenly develop a high fever. At this time, the patient must pay attention to timely medical treatment, because you may have epididymitis. But some people often wonder, what causes the disease? 1. Acute non-specific orchitis often occurs in patients with urethritis, cystitis, prostatitis, patients after prostatectomy and patients with long-term indwelling urinary catheters. The infection spreads to the epididymis through the lymph or vas deferens, causing epididymal orchitis. Common pathogens are E. coli, Proteus, Staphylococcus and Pseudomonas aeruginosa. Bacteria can spread to the testicles through the bloodstream, causing simple orchitis. 2. Chronic orchitis is mostly caused by incomplete treatment of non-specific acute orchitis. It can also be caused by fungal, spirochetal, or parasitic infections, such as testicular syphilis. Patients with previous testicular trauma may develop granulomatous orchitis. Local or whole-body radioactive isotope phosphorus irradiation of the testicles can also cause orchitis and damage the testicular tissue. 3. Mumps is the most common cause of orchitis. About 20% of patients with mumps have orchitis. It is more common in late puberty. The testicles are highly enlarged and purple-blue in color. When the testicles are cut open, the testicular tubules cannot be squeezed out due to the reaction and edema of the interstitial tissue. Histological observations show edema and vascular dilation, a large number of inflammatory cells infiltrate, and varying degrees of degeneration of the seminiferous tubules. When orchitis heals, the testicles become smaller and soft. The seminiferous tubules are severely atrophied, but the testicular interstitial cells are preserved, so the secretion of testosterone is not affected.
